Blue Cross Accused of Misleading Consumers – In the first year of the Affordable Care Act going into effect, the giant health insurance company Anthem Blue Cross has been accused of misleading hundreds of thousands of clients in California with false publicity. The company is facing a class-action lawsuit. A truck driver from Bakersfield, California says he was one of the people who ran up against an unpleasant surprise when he had to use his health insurance. Our reporter Rubén Tapia has the story.

Creating Theater for Community – How can theater – a source of entertainment and fun – also be used to heal, bring justice, educate, and mobilize the public? Throughout his artistic career, Californian actor and educator Luis Santiago, or “Xago”, Juarez has set out to explore this question. In his work with the legendary Teatro Campesino, in the public schools, in street theater, one of his goals has been to mobilize the audience to social action using comedy or drama, and to make the stage a place for the stories of the whole community. Fernando Andrés Torres reports from San José, California, where he met with Xago Juarez. This feature is part of the series Raíces: Los Maestros.
